Tabanoidea
Superfamily of flies
Tabanoidea
Scientific classification
Domain:
Eukaryota
Kingdom:
Animalia
Phylum:
Arthropoda
Class:
Insecta
Order:
Diptera
Infraorder:
Tabanomorpha
Superfamily:
Tabanoidea
Families
Athericidae
Oreoleptidae
Pelecorhynchidae
Tabanidae
Superfamily
Tabanoidea
are insects in the order
Diptera
.
